StillMarillion return to Aberdeen for a very special one-off show — “Farewell to ’26” — a powerful recreation of Marillion’s legendary “Farewell to ’86” performance at the iconic Barrowland Ballroom.
Widely regarded as Europe’s leading Marillion tribute, StillMarillion capture the sound, atmosphere and emotion of the classic Fish-era with stunning accuracy. Fronted by Martin Jakubski (of the Steve Rothery Band), the band bring an authenticity and intensity that has earned them a reputation across the UK and Europe.
This exclusive show revisits a defining moment in Marillion history — the emotional farewell performances that marked the end of an era. Expect a set packed with era-defining classics delivered with the drama, energy and passion that made the original show so unforgettable.

StillMarillion pay homage to the classic Fish era of Marillion.
StillMarillion formed in 2008 and feature the vocal talents of Martin Jakubski, in 2014 Martin was chosen by original Marillion guitar player Steve Rothery to be part of his solo band and has since toured extensively over Europe with the Steve Rothery Band.
The lineup is completed by four excellent and experienced musicians who recreate the sounds of classic Marillion at venues all over the UK and Europe.
